- Support evaluate() calls from VM service in expression compiler
- emit all accessed symbols, types, constants, extension symbols,
and imports as part of synthetic evaluation function
- Note: this fixes missing symbol issues in evaluateInFrame()
as well
- update expression evaluation tests
- fix expression compilation broken after hot reload
